What is The SoulWord Story Method™?

The SoulWord Story Method™ is a writing process that starts with one emotionally charged word—what I call a SoulWord. It’s a word that holds weight, a word that pulls something up from deep within you.

From that single word, we freewrite, reflect, and begin uncovering the personal stories that want to be told.

It’s not about being a perfect writer.

It’s about being honest.

The method guides you step-by-step—from raw emotion to meaningful narrative—so you can process your experiences, connect with your truth, and ultimately write a story that could heal yourself and others.

For some, it becomes a book.

For others, it’s a deep personal journey.

But either way, the method gives you permission to finally speak what’s been buried inside.

How It Works

Choose Your SoulWord

A gut-punch word that holds meaning for you, often tied to something you’ve lived through, buried, or are still healing from.

FreeWrite with No Editing

This is the ‘messy middle’—the part where emotion meets the page before logic catches up. It’s raw. Honest. Unfiltered.

Reflect on What Came Up

What came up during the writing? What memories resurfaced? What themes are asking for attention?

Sketch Out a Detailed Scene

Turning emotion into story starts by capturing a moment—using sensory detail to make it real and tangible.

Name What You're Carrying Forward

This part is about clarity—what did this word, this writing session, reveal to you.

Once you’ve moved through several of these SoulWord Cycles, the method helps you spot patterns, themes, and narrative threads. You begin to see how these emotional entries can become chapters.
